| 4/15/2013 | | Forbes: Why Are Small Investors Still Buying Gold? A Psychology Lesson |
| | The Disconnect Between the Physical and Paper Gold Market Last week saw the most precipitous fall in gold prices in almost two years. On Friday, on the Multi-Commodity Exchange of India gold suffered its biggest daily loss ever, and gold futures for June delivery plunged $63.50, or 4.1%, to settle just above $1,500 an ounce on the Comex in New York, the weakest closing since July, 2011. Holdings in GLD the SPDR Gold trust ETF and the biggest exchange fund backed by gold bullion, hit 1,181.4 metric tons, the lowest in nearly three years. Today at the time of this writing gold is off nearly another 4%, trading around $1420 an ounce, more than a 20% decline from its all time high of 1923.70. | 4/11/2013 | | Psychology Today: "Human Trafficking In America" |
| | Human
Trafficking is defined by the United Nations Office on Drugs and Crime as "the acquisition of people by improper means such as
force, fraud or deception, with the aim of exploiting them."Sex is just one aspect of trafficking. Forced labor, slavery,
servitude and even forced organ donation are other horrifying aspects of this
disturbing and growing activity. Human trafficking rakes in an estimated $32
BILLION a year and is tied with arms dealing as the second largest criminal industry in the world (drugs are number 1). This should scare the hell out of each and
